Experimental creation of entanglement using separable state
Quantum Physics
2009-11-10 v1
Abstract
We experimentally demonstrate the entanglement can be created on two distant particles using separate state. We show that two data particles can share some entanglement while one ancilla particle always remains separable from them during the experimental evolution of the system. Our experiment can be viewed as a benchmark to illustrate the idea that no prior entanglement is necessary to create entanglement.
